A Vienna porcelain figure group of a Pilgrim Family, Circa 1760
modelled as a seated man and a woman with child, the parents each wearing a black shoulder cape with shells at the shoulders, all seated on a rockwork wall, the rocky mound base edged with a gilt-scroll border, shield mark in underglaze-blue
height 7 5/8 in.
18.7 cm
Condition Report:
Overall generally good condition, and good appearance. The male figure's cloak with a flat chip to edge at reverse, measuring approx. 0.5 x 0.5 cm. A fold edge of the baby's puce blanket with a tiny flat chip.
